Summary: In POCSO Case No. 103/2016 (Cooch Behar), the court proceeded with multiple orders spanning 2019-2026. Accused Kutubuddin Mollah's bail petition was rejected in March 2019 due to lack of supporting medical documents. Accused Abed Ali Mollah was initially denied bail but granted interim bail of Rs. 4,000 with sureties in March 2019; subsequent confirmation petitions were extended but not confirmed. The case has been repeatedly adjourned due to accused absences and non-receipt of warrant execution reports, with the latest adjournment fixed for May 21, 2026.
